Hmm.... this commit seems to be a part of the following series: a78cf9657ba5 PCI/ACPI: Evaluate PCI Boot Configuration _DSM 7ac0d094fbe9 PCI: Don't auto-realloc if we're preserving firmware config 3e8ba9686600 arm64: PCI: Allow resource reallocation if necessary 85dc04136e86 arm64: PCI: Preserve firmware configuration when desired OK, after reading through the commit messages in those commits (esp. 7ac0d094fbe9), I think the Linux change was made exactly for the purpose that we want it for -- stick with the firmware assignments.
